How Our Industrial Dehumidification Service Actually Works
We know that a proper process matters with Industrial Dehumidification. That’s why our team follows a step-by-step approach to ensure your property is restored to its former glory. We’ll assess the damage, develop a customized plan, and execute it with precision and care.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our technicians will inspect your property to identify the source of the moisture and develop a customized plan to address it. We’ll explain the process, answer your questions, and provide a clear timeline for completion.
Step 2: Dehumidification and Drying
We’ll deploy our top-of-the-line d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ture from the air. Our equipment is designed to work efficiently, reducing drying times and preventing further damage.
Step 3: Monitoring and Adjustments
Our technicians will closely monitor the drying process, making adjustments as needed to ensure best results. We’ll keep you informed throughout the process, so you know exactly what to expect.
Step 4: Final Inspection and Certification
Once the drying process is complete, our technicians will conduct a final inspection to ensure your property is safe and dry. We’ll provide a certification of completion and a guarantee of our work.

Industrial Dehumidification v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ill in your basement | Yes | No | DIY solutions can handle small spills, but for larger areas, it’s best to call a pro. |
| Musty odors in your crawl space | No | Yes | DIY solutions won’t be effective in removing musty odors in crawl spaces. Call a pro for professional-grade equipment. |
| Water damage from a burst pipe | No | Yes | DIY solutions won’t be able to handle the volume of water from a burst pipe. Call a pro for fast and effective drying. |
| High humidity in your attic | No | Yes | DIY solutions won’t be able to handle the scale of high humidity in your attic. Call a pro for professional-grade equipment. |

Industrial Dehumidification Cost in Foxborough, MA
The cost of Industrial Dehumidification can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Foxborough, MA. These estimates are based on real-world costs and can give you an idea of what to expect.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Dehumidification and Drying | $500 – $2,500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ions |
| Monitoring and Adjustments | $100 – $500 | Frequency of monitoring, complexity of adjustments |
| Final Inspection and Certification | $50 – $200 | Complexity of inspection, number of certifications required |
